Responsibilities
- Provide direct nursing care to post-acute skilled residents per the planned care pathway
- Administer prescribed medications and document in the EPIC system; monitor patient responses
- Monitor vital signs and clinical status; promptly communicate changes to the supervising RN or charge nurse
- Assist residents with activities of daily living and support rehabilitation/therapeutic activities
- Collaborate with the interdisciplinary team to update care plans and participate in rounds as needed
- Adhere to safety and infection control protocols; support appropriate patient transfers and documentation
